More Malaysians are cruising to Singapore – here’s why


Tourism receipts from Malaysia to Singapore has increased in 2017 and was largely contributed by an increase in visitors from Penang, Ipoh and visitors from East Malaysia. – STB

Singapore registered a record high growth in tourism in 2017, thanks in part to large number of Malaysians taking cruises from the island country.

With the increased demand for cruise holidays and packages, Malaysians added strong growth (+29%) to the city-state’s visitor numbers. Tourism receipts from Malaysia to Singapore increased by 11% to S$608m (RM1,793.78m), with expenditure on shopping being a key factor.
